A participating mindset between the opposing celebrations can shorten the discovery process. When lawyers and their clients want to trade information without unnecessary problem or delay, the whole process runs much more efficiently. This includes replying to discovery requests immediately and working together to set up depositions efficiently. On the other hand, specific features of a situation can bring about a much shorter exploration stage. When responsibility is clear and undisputed, such as in many rear-end accident instances, there is less need for comprehensive investigation right into the source of the mishap.

Your injury attorney will likely advise waiting to work out until you have actually reached a point called maximum clinical enhancement or MMI. MMI means you've recovered as completely as doctors anticipate with therapy. If the insurance company approves liability rapidly and uses a reasonable negotiation, the process might just take a couple of weeks or approximately 2 or three months. Nevertheless, if the insurance provider concerns liability or tries to pay less than you are entitled to, the instance can take longer to work out.
